The 880 mm-wide family starts here, pairing a moderate footprint with a 34.56 V open-circuit voltage. That makes it a comfortable fit for 24 V banks and keeps string voltages healthy when several modules are wired in series.
Where it fits best
- 24 V off-grid homes and small businesses
- Grid-tie strings on roofs with moderate available area
- Systems that will expand in series rather than in parallel
Technical specifications
| Maximum Power (Pmax) | 240 W |
|---|---|
| Open Circuit Voltage (Voc) | 34.56 V |
| Short Circuit Current (Isc) | 8.83 A |
| Voltage at Pmax (Vmp) | 28.8 V |
| Current at Pmax (Imp) | 8.33 A |
| Module Efficiency | 20.2 % |
| Power Tolerance | 0, +4.99W |
| Maximum System Voltage | 700 V DC |
| Max Series Fuse Rating | 15 A |
| Module Type | 210M240 |
| Solar Cells | Mono crystalline 210*105mm (4*12Pcs) |
| External Dimensions | 1350*880*30mm |
| Weight | 12.51 kg |
| Front Glass | 3.2 mm tempered glass |
| Frame | Aluminum |
| Junction Box | IP67 |
| Output Cables | 70CM 2.5mm² Cable |
| Connector | MC4 Compatible |
| Mechanical Load | Front Side Max. 5400Pa, Rear Side Max. 2400Pa |
| Pmax Temperature Coefficient | -0.350%/°C |
| Voc Temperature Coefficient | -0.270%/°C |
| Isc Temperature Coefficient | +0.048%/°C |
| Package Dimensions | 1360*67*890mm |
| Package Weight | 27 kg |
| Pieces per Package | 2 |
Questions buyers ask
How many can I run in series on a 150 V controller?
Allowing for cold-morning voltage rise, three of these modules is a conservative answer for a 150 V input; your installer should verify against local minimum temperatures.
Does the 880 mm width suit standard racking?
Yes, standard clamps fit the framed edge. The width affects layout planning more than hardware compatibility.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is a monocrystalline solar panel?
A panel built from single-crystal silicon cells, giving higher efficiency and a smaller footprint than polycrystalline types.
Do panels work on cloudy days?
Yes, at reduced output — typically 10–50% of clear-sky levels depending on how thick the cloud cover is.
How long do solar panels last?
Quality modules commonly retain most of their output for 20–25 years thanks to tempered glass and aluminium frames.
Can I connect panels to a battery?
Panels feed an MPPT charge controller or hybrid inverter, which safely charges the connected battery bank.
